18U: FALCONS FLY PAST AVALANCHE 7-1

STRUTHERS, OH- The Astro Falcons scored early and often en route to an easy 7-1 victory over Avalanche Monday evening in Class B play.

Brayden Beck picked up the win for Astro, allowing just one hit on three hits in six strong innings, while striking out seven and walking three.  Trey Giannini suffered the loss for Avalanche, yielding four runs in three innings of work.

Beck helped himself at the plate with two hits, including an RBI triple, and scored a run for Astro in the win.  Chase Franken and Lucas Gulczynski each slugged a pair of hits and scored a run while Burke Camper hit a double and touched home twice in the win.

Marshall Weinberg hit an RBI single in the game for Avalanche.
